Signal Processing & Fourier Analysis: From raw measurement data to reliable technical decisions

In modern technical systems, measurement data is everywhere. Sensors continuously measure vibration, pressure, temperature, flow and electrical signals. In practice, this data is rarely clean. Noise, disturbances and unstable behaviour make it difficult to determine what a system is actually doing. Signal processing is the discipline that enables engineers to solve this problem.

Training content
The training course consists of 11 evening sessions of three hours.

Each session combines theory with practical assignments in Python. Under the guidance of trainer Shahrad “Sadra” Ghanbari, you will work on industrial cases such as vibration analysis of motors, resonance in structures and noise reduction in measurement systems.

You will learn:

  • The fundamentals of Fourier, Laplace and wavelet transforms

  • How to analyse signals in the frequency domain

  • Noise reduction and fault detection in Python

  • How to build spectral filters and analysis tools

  • How to link data to physical processes and design decisions

During the training course, you will build your own analysis tool with a graphical user interface, which you can take with you after the course and apply in your own work.

The programme
  • Evening 1: Introduction, Python for Engineers, Vector Spaces and Signals
  • Evening 2: Fourier Series and Data Decomposition, including Singular Value Decomposition in Python
  • Evening 3: Fourier Transforms, FFT and Python Applications
  • Evening 4: Laplace and Z-Transforms, Filter Design in the Time and Frequency Domain, including IIR vs FIR Filters in Python and Microcontrollers
  • Evening 5: Time-Frequency Analysis, including STFT, Gabor and Wavelet Transforms in Python, and an Introduction to the Dosign Signal Analysis Application
  • Evening 6: Probability in Signals and the Wiener Filter, including the mathematically optimal filter, adaptive filtering, Python and microcontrollers
  • Evening 7: Linear Algebra in Signal Processing, Sparsity and Compressed Sensing, including how sparse signals can be reconstructed below the conventional Nyquist sampling rate using Python
  • Evening 8: Control Theory and Nonlinear Filtering, including damping of oscillations and Python implementation
  • Evening 9: Adaptive Sparsity and Filtering, including Python implementation
  • Evening 10: Connecting the Concepts, including the implementation of multi-purpose algorithms in Python

    The training course also includes four practical case studies and a final project.

The target audience

Who is this training intended for?

This training course is intended for engineers who work with measurement data and sensors and want to understand what their data really means.

The training course is suitable for:

  • instrumentation engineers
  • automation engineers
  • mechanical engineers working with vibration or dynamic behaviour
  • engineers in R&D, maintenance or asset management
  • engineers who work with Python and want to deepen their analysis skills

The training course requires technical understanding, but no academic background in signal theory. Mathematics is used functionally and is always linked to practical applications.
